Casio G-Shock alarm not working

I have a Casio G-Shock model dw-9051 (the "classic" style)-unlike everyone else, I can't get my alarm to go ON. The icon for the alarm chime is there, and I can turn it on and off with the alarm on/off button (top right). When the time comes around the watch blinks as if the alarm is going off but I have no sound. I don't have a manual so I'm confused-since this watch may have applications for the military, is there a way to deactivate the alarm chime for safety, and if so, what is this procedure? Other than the chime module being shot I can't imagine why it's not going off when it is supposed to. Thanks.

  • bobsmith277 Jan 26, 2011

    The problem is the piezo alarm inside the back of the watch, once the thin coating on it is scratched off, it will no longer work. If you look, there will probably be a scratch where a spring or small piece of the watch works touch it. This happens when the back of the watch is removed and replaced sometimes. If you replace the back of the watch it will work again, but good luck getting another back.

Model & spring issue with an ol casio G-Shock when replacing batt

This spring is connector to caseback for transmitting sound. Get an eyeglass and find out on movement backplate written SPRING COIL and put it back. If there is no marking SPRING COIL then check for the hole with approx. same diameter as spring (must easy fit in). The hole shoud be empty with contact spot at the bottom. Put the spring in and close the caseback. Check alarm sound. If it works, you did find the right hole- if not, try again till you find the right one.

I had the battery in my Casio G Shock DW 6800 replaced. Since then none of the beeps or alarms have worked. Is there a reset button he didn't press?

There is a reset button inside your watch, but I don't think that is the problem. Most likely, there is a spring that makes contact to the watch and the back of your watch case, and it fell out by the person replacing your battery. I would definitely go back to the place where you had the battery installed, and have them take care of the problem buy ordering you a new spring or have them pay for you to send it to Casio.

I had my battery replaced in my Casio G Shock DW -6800. Since then the beeps and alarms are not working. Is there some sort of reset button he forgot to press?

There are two internal springs that contact the back cover of the watch through an insulator. The alarm nor chime will work if they were not put into their proper locations or were omitted during reassembly.
